My complaint:

My son took his 2015 CHEVROLET CAMARO IN BECAUSE THE AC STOPPED WORKING. They have had the vehicle 3 weeks they got the new AC put in but the people who put the WINSHIELD BACK IN CUT ALL THE WIRES AND NOW THEY HAVE TO ORDER MORE PARTS TO FIX IT. Someone should have been watching over this to make sure this kind of problem never happened , it’s my sons car and they didn’t offer to give he a vehicle to drive. They said it might take two weeks, meanwhile, he is driving my car till they correct all the mistakes they have made . His windows doesn’t work he can’t lock his car , and they have had ample time to complete this problem, I am very upset with this dealership, and want action taken against them !!!!
